Senior Hardware Engineer
Company:
Akamai Technologies
Join our Server Team to help build the next generation of cloud server architecture. As a Senior Hardware Engineer you will focus on the Smart
NIC/DPU software and hardware that underpins our compute and GPU servers.
- Driving DPU hardware and software integration into Akamai compute and GPU server platforms, including PCIe, networking, storage, and manageability interfaces.
- Planning and executing validation for DPU platforms, including functional, performance, interoperability, stress, and reliability testing for data‑center scale use cases.
- Implementing and validating networking and offload features such as RDMA/RoCE, L2/L3/L4 Ethernet/IP forwarding, SR‑IOV/virtio‑net/vDPA, overlay networks, and congestion control behaviors.
- Developing automation, scripts, and test tooling to exercise DPUs, collect telemetry at scale, and turn results into requirements.
- Collaborating closely with cross‑functional teams to translate workload and SLO requirements into software and hardware configurations and test plans.
- Working with vendors to evaluate new DPU generations, firmware and feature updates, and trade‑offs between performance, efficiency, supply continuity, and TCO.
- 8+ years of relevant engineering experience and a Bachelor’s degree in Computer Engineering or a related field.
- Experience with data‑center Smart
NICs or DPUs, integration into x86/ARM servers, and familiarity with PCIe, SR‑IOV, and virtualization concepts. - Solid understanding of networking fundamentals and familiarity with VXLAN, BGP, RDMA/RoCE, congestion control, and load balancing in large‑scale data centers.
- Experience with platform validation, PCIe/NVMe and networking qualification, and system‑level stress testing.
- Linux skills and proficiency with scripting languages such as Python and Bash for automation and data analysis.
- Comfortable working across HW/FW/SW boundaries, collaborating with teams to debug issues in the data path, control plane, and management stack.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to describe problems and solutions to both technical and non‑technical audiences.
